Statistic Bow Valley Nebraska National
Population 96 1,934,408 328,239,523
Population density (sq mi) 673 25 91
Median age 41.6 36.2 37.7
Male/Female ratio 1.0:1 1.0:1 1.0:1
Married (15yrs & older) 62% 59% 55%
Families w/ Kids under 18 33% 45% 43%
Speak English 100% 89% 79%
Speak Spanish 0% 7% 13%

      Bow Valley racial demographics

      Race Bow Valley Nebraska National
      White 100.00% 88.01% 73.35%
      Black 0.00% 4.70% 12.63%
      Asian 0.00% 2.12% 5.22%
      American Indian 0.00% 0.84% 0.82%
      Native Hawaiian 0.00% 0.07% 0.18%
      Mixed race 0.00% 2.32% 3.06%
      Other race 0.00% 1.95% 4.75%
      In Bow Valley, 0.0% of people are of Hispanic or Latino origin.
      Please note: Hispanics may be of any race, so also are included in any/all of the applicable race categories above.
